Pierce Transit is an independent municipal organization, dedicated to fulfilling the mission of improving people's quality of life by providing safe, reliable, and accessible transportation services that are locally based and regionally connected. We are recruiting an experienced Information Technology Manager/CIO to lead Pierce Transit's Information Technology department, reporting to the Chief Financial Officer. This position provides senior-level technical expertise across multiple disciplines and is responsible for the secure, reliable, and efficient operation of agency technology systems, including networks, telecommunications, integrated business applications, cybersecurity, and other critical systems that support public transit services.

The IT Manager will lead, support, and develop a skilled technology team, coordinate multiple simultaneous projects and priorities, and work closely with senior-level stakeholders across Pierce Transit to understand business needs and recommend effective technology solutions. This position oversees technology strategy, budgeting, resource planning, critical systems management, and long-term technology planning. The ideal candidate will bring broad technical expertise, strong leadership and communication skills, and the ability to align people, processes, and technology in support of agency goals.

This role will be expected to foster innovation, support staff development, facilitate collaboration across departments, and provide strategic recommendations that strengthen Pierce Transit's technology environment and operational effectiveness. Essential Functions The following functions are not intended to serve as a comprehensive list of all duties performed in this classification, only a representative summary of the primary duties and responsibilities. Incumbent(s) may not be required to perform all duties listed and may be required to perform additional, position-specific duties.

Provides strategic level advice to the Executive team regarding information technology. Plans, develops, coordinates, and implements information systems to meet the Agency's technology needs. Provides leadership and direction to the Information Technology Department to support the Agency's business goals and Strategic Plan.

Develops and monitors implementation of department goals, objectives, priorities, and effectiveness of service delivery methods and procedures. Develops and coordinates implementation of the Information Technology Strategic Plan. Leads incident response, disaster recovery, and business continuity planning.

Ensures compliance with accessibility, records retention, and data privacy requirements. Supervises the work of assigned personnel, including assigning and reviewing work, providing guidance, and conducting performance evaluations. Oversees the management of multiple, concurrent, large IT projects, primarily in project planning and development, oversight, and sponsorship roles.

Coordinates feasibility studies, prepares requests for proposals, and oversees selection and work of consultants and vendors. Monitors progress, evaluates and accepts work or products, verifies charges, and oversees required remedial action. Prepares a variety of complex narrative and statistical reports, proposals, and recommendations.

Develops, disseminates, and enforces policies, work rules, and procedures that ensure Agency computers, systems, and data are secure from unauthorized internal and external access. Researches, recommends and deploys new technologies. Maintains expertise in the area of architecture and cybersecurity.

Advises on technology risk management and internal controls Develops and administers departmental operating budget. Oversees Agency capital and operating budget for technology. Manages department and budgets according to IT asset management best practices, data retention, computing, and cloud infrastructure.

Communicates projects information and manages relationships with cross-functional departments, external agencies, and outside vendors. Forecasts for future funds needed for staffing, equipment, materials, projects, and supplies. Monitors and controls expenditures to department operating and capital budgets.

Develops and maintains partnerships with other departments. Collaboratively identifies solutions and provides clear and timely proactive communication. Supports and develops strong, effective teams by coaching staff, promoting collaboration, building skills, and creating an accountable, high-performing work environment.

Provides technical direction and resolves complex design and project or contract scope issues. Represents the department with Pierce Transit Board, staff, and representatives of outside agencies. Demonstrates reliable and consistent attendance.

Performs related work as required. Pierce Transit employees participate in the Washington Public Employees' Retirement System (PERS) administered by the Department of Retirement Systems (DRS). Employees must elect to participate in PERS Plan 2 or PERS Plan 3. Employees who have participated in the Tacoma Employee's Retirement System (TERS) may elect to continue to participate in that system.

Employees in the PERS system do not pay the 6.2% Social Security tax but are still responsible for a 1.45% payment for Medicare. Pierce Transit offers $5,000 per year (up to a total of $18,000) in Tuition Assistance after your one-year anniversary. Certifications, and career skills must be connected to a job at Pierce Transit

Pierce Transit provides an ORCA Card benefit for each employee and a family member. This benefit provides free access to service on Pierce Transit, Sound Transit, Community Transit, Everett Transit, King County Metro, Kitsap Transit, Seattle Monorail, Seattle Streetcar, King County Water Taxi and Kitsap Foot Ferry. PAID LEAVE: Full-time Pierce Transit employees receive 11 paid holidays, 2 personal paid holidays, eligibility to earn 2 wellness days, 6 days of major sick leave, and 22 days of paid time off (PTO) per year.

PTO accrual rates increase per policy.
